Response 2: Thank you for pointing this out. We've noticed the problem and have made the change you suggested to include the sentence in that location: Brassinosteroids (BRs), recognized as the sixth major class of plant hormones, play crucial roles in various aspects of plant growth and development, including seed germination, cell elongation, photomorphogenesis, xylem differentiation, and reproduction [1]. Not only do they contribute to normal plant development, but they also assist in resisting high-salinity and alkaline conditions. Exogenous application of BRs has been shown to bolster seed resistance to salinity stress [2,3,4,5,6], while also alleviating the harmful effects of saline conditions and alkali on plant health, according to studies [7,8]. BR signal kinase (BSK) is an important cytoplasmic receptor kinase downstream of the BR signal transduction pathway that serves as a substrate of brassinosteroid receptor BRI [9] and plays a crucial role in regulating plant growth, development, and abiotic stress responses.

Comments 3: Another problem is the novelty and content of the paper, as the paper only identifies the gene family, so there must be more data, like I would suggest to add gene expression profiling under various other stresses as well, like drought, heavy metal, heat stress etc. I am quite sure, there must be some RNA seq data available from where the authors can get the gene expression data.

Response 3: Thank you for pointing this out. In the whole article, because we only studied the salt stress of this gene family, it is not suitable to add RNA-seq data for other abiotic stresses. Therefore, only the registration numbers of: SRR7160314-SRR7160315, SRR7160322-SRR7160331, SRR7160339-SRR7160341, SRR7160351-SRR7160352 and SRR7160354-SRR7160357; SRR1823816-SRR1823833 were downloaded from NCBI. These data were aligned with ‘XinJiangDaYe’ as the reference genome. The final PFKM values were calculated to plot a heat map for the display of gene expression.

Comments 8: The introduction lacks information related to salinity stress and its impact on Alfalfa crop, so provide at least one paragraph of 3-4 lines which explains that how salinity impacts Alfalfa crop and why it is very important stress for this crop.

Response 8: Thank you for your suggestion! The newly added sentence is: High-salt environments induce osmotic stress and ion toxicity in alfalfa, leading to stunted growth and reduced biomass. Consequently, understanding the mechanisms of salt tolerance in alfalfa and developing effective salt tolerance strategies are essential to mitigatinge the adverse effects of salinity stress on this crop.

Comments 9: Verify if the AtBSK needs to be italic or not

Response 9: Thank you for your suggestion! The convention is to italicize the abbreviations of gene names when they are used to refer to the gene itself. Therefore, "AtBSK" should be italicized when it is first mentioned to indicate that it is a gene name. However, the use of "AtBSK" in the following text is mainly used to refer to protein sequences, so italics are no longer used.
